This Barrie, Ontario hotel is a 10-minute drive from the Barrie Molson Center multi-purpose arena. It features an indoor pool with whirlpool,
Every room features an exposed brick wall and is classically furnished. Cable TV, a refrigerator and work desk are all provided and select rooms at Barrie Travelodge have a spacious sitting area. The spacious lobby at Travelodge Barrie on Bayfield, which also has exposed brick walls, offers free newspapers and a public computer station. Free Wi-Fi is provided throughout the hotel. Arboretum Sunnidale Park is 2.5 km from the hotel and the Georgian Downs Raceway is a 15-minute drive away. Canada's Wonderland amusement park is a 50-minute drive away.
